Course Description
Overview
Most applications rely on databases to store data. Understanding how to create a database and communicate with it unlocks a critical power in your web development career.
In this course, Tyler presents all the building blocks of creating and interacting with a PostgreSQL database. From creating a brand new table, up through organizing and aggregating data across multiple tables, you will learn the fundamental skills of SQL — and you’ll be prepared to apply them right away.
After completing this course, you’ll be ready to tackle more challenging SQL topics like proper data modeling, normalizing data, and exploring different database types.

Syllabus
- Setup and Introduction to SQL Fundamentals
- Create a Table with SQL Create
- Add Data to a Table with SQL Insert
- Query Data with the Select Command in SQL
- Update Data in a Table with SQL Update
- Removing Data with SQL Delete, Truncate, and Drop
- Keep Data Integrity with Constraints
- Organize Table Data with Indexes
- Select Grouped and Aggregated Data with SQL
- Conditionally Select out Filtered Data with SQL Where
- Combining Tables Together with SQL Join Statements
- Subquery Dynamic Datasets in SQL
